Each day, we experience noise in our environment, such as the audios from television and radio, home home appliances, and website traffic. Generally, these sounds go to risk-free degrees that do not harm our hearing. Noises can be unsafe when they are as well loud, also for a short time, or when they are both loud and resilient.
NIHL can be prompt or it can take a long period of time to be obvious. It can be momentary or long-term, and it can impact one ear or both ears. Also if you can not tell that you are damaging your hearing, you can have problem hearing in the future, such as not having the ability to comprehend various other individuals when they chat, particularly on the phone or in a loud area.
Direct exposure to unsafe noise can happen at any kind of age. Individuals of any ages, including children, teens, young people, and older people, can create NIHL. Based upon a 2011-2012 CDC research study entailing hearing examinations and meetings with individuals, at least 10 million grownups (6 percent) in the U.S. under age 70and probably as numerous as 40 million grownups (24 percent)have features of their hearing examination that suggest hearing loss in one or both ears from exposure to loud sound.
Sound is gauged in systems called decibels. Appears at or listed below 70 A-weighted decibels (dBA), even after lengthy exposure, are not likely to cause hearing loss. However, lengthy or repetitive exposure to audios at or over 85 dBA can create hearing loss. The louder the sound, the shorter the amount of time it takes for NIHL to take place.
A great guideline is to stay clear of noises that are as well loud, too close, or last also long. Hearing depends on a collection of events that transform audio waves airborne into electric signals
Source: NIH/NIDCD Acoustic wave enter the external ear and traveling via a slim passageway called the ear canal, which leads to the tympanum. The tympanum shakes from the inbound noise waves and sends out these vibrations to three tiny bones in the center ear. These bones are called the malleus, incus, and stapes.
As the hair cells go up and down, microscopic hair-like forecasts (recognized as stereocilia) that perch on top of the hair cells bump versus an overlying framework and bend. Flexing reasons pore-like channels, which are at the suggestions of the stereocilia, to open. When that happens, chemicals hurry right into the cell, creating an electric signal.

Much acoustic injury is triggered by impulse noise, which is generally due to blast impact and the quick expansion of gases. Influence sound results from the collision of metals.
Influence sound is more likely to be seen in the context of job-related sound direct exposure. Animals with huge PTS from a preliminary sound exposure showed much less PTS complying with second sound exposure at a specific strength compared with animals with little or no previous NIHL, suggesting that these animals are less sensitive to succeeding sound direct exposures.
This recommends that the major factor in charge of these results is lower efficient strength of the second noise for the ears with big preliminary PTS. Other physiologic problems that influence the possibility and progression of NIHL have actually been determined. Evidence appears in the literary works that decreased body temperature level, enhanced oxygen stress, decreased cost-free radical formation, and elimination of the thyroid gland can all decrease an individual's sensitivity to NIHL.
Great experimental evidence shows that continual exposure to moderately high degrees of noise can decrease a person's sensitivity to NIHL at higher degrees of noise. This procedure is described as audio conditioning. It goes to the very least superficially comparable to the safety impact a calculated training regimen has for extreme physical activity.
